Cooler Master is a household name when it comes to computer cases, and the HAF 912 is a rugged-looking and attractive mid-tower that is compatible with standard ATX motherboards. The design is optimized for maximum airflow and contains room for a 120mm radiator and up to six 120mm fans to keep your system cool. The case also offers space for 12 devices, including large, high-end graphics cards.

The CX750 is an 80 Plus Bronze-certified PSU that delivers 750 watts of power, and is both ATX and EPS12V-compatible. Extra-long sleeved cables allow for cleaner cord management even in extra-tall cases, and over-voltage, under-voltage, over-power, and short circuit protection help keep your PC running safely.

The GA-Z170X-UD3 features a LGA1151 socket for use with sixth- and seventh-generation Intel Core processors. Four dual-channel DDR4 DIMM slots give you plenty of space for RAM upgrades, while three SATA Express, six SATA3, and two M.2 slots provide multiple options for internal storage. PCI Express slots include one 3.0 x16, one 3.0 x8, one 3.0 x4, and three 3.0 x1 buses.

Eight cores provide a standard clock speed of 4.0GHz, which is clockable up to 5.0GHz with AMD OverDrive software. The CPU is designed for AMD AM3 sockets and features an 8MB L3 cache, along with four 2MB L2 caches.
